What they have told you is complete bollox I have recently left ford after working for them as a specialist technician for 7 years .
The focus ST170 suffers from vibration and sticky throttle cables there is a revised part that they should change F.O.C. or at least honour part of the costs The revised cable is longer and is routed across the engine diffrently .
With regards to the running faults they should connect WDS up to your ST and carry out the nessasary PCM updates to correct hessitation and stumble on acceleration and deceleration.
